Crystal structure of human Maf1
Template:ABSTRACT PUBMED 20887893
Function
[MAF1_HUMAN] Element of the mTORC1 signaling pathway that acts as a mediator of diverse signals and that represses RNA polymerase III transcription. Inhibits the de novo assembly of TFIIIB onto DNA.[1] [2] [3]
About this Structure
3nr5 is a 1 chain structure with sequence from Homo sapiens. Full crystallographic information is available from OCA.
